农业物联网工程设计与实施项目六物联网应用软件设计53课件.pptxVIP

  • 1
  • 0
  • 约1.23千字
  • 约 11页
  • 2025-10-16 发布于陕西
  • 举报

农业物联网工程设计与实施项目六物联网应用软件设计53课件.pptx

农业物联网工程设计与实施设施农业与装备专业资源库建设项目六物联网应用软件设计上海农林职业技术学院设施农业与装备教研室6.1软件测试-微软软件产品开发过程

微软的软件产品开发过程一、微软的组织结构市场营销部内部营运部产品开发部研究部门项目六物联网应用软件设计6.1软件测试

二、新产品的产生过程新产品项目的提议市场分析与预测技术可行性分析产品研发实施步骤高层论证和审批项目确立和执行产品开发项目六物联网应用软件设计6.1软件测试

三、微软的产品团队软件开发项目管理软件测试产品管理后勤管理用户培训------微软产品团队的组成互相沟通项目六物联网应用软件设计6.1软件测试

1、利用因果图产生测试用例的基本步骤1、分析软件规格说明书中,哪些是原因(即输入条件或输入条件的等价类),哪些是结果(即输出条件)并给每个原因和结果赋予一个标识。2、分析软件规格说明书中所描述的语义,找出原因与结果之间、原因与原因之间对应的是什么关系?根据这些关系画出因果图。项目六物联网应用软件设计6.1软件测试

3、由于语法或环境的限制,有些原因与原因之间、原因与结果之间的组合情况不可能出现。为表明这些特殊情况,在因果图上用一些记号标明约束或限制条件。4、把因果图转换为判断表5、把判断表的每一列拿出来作为依据,设计测试用例。项目六物联网应用软件设计6.1软件测试

或(∨):表示若几个原因中有一个出现,则结果出现,而当这几个原因都不出现时,结果才不出现。C1E1C2∨C1E1C2∧与(∧):表示若几个原因都出现,则结果才出现若几个原因中有一个不出现,结果就不出现。项目六物联网应用软件设计6.1软件测试

三、实体-关系图----DD(DataDictionary)在数据密集型应用问题中,对复杂数据及数据之间复杂关系和建模将成为需求分析的重要任务。显然,这项任务是简单的数据字典机制是无法胜任的。为此,在下面的内容将介绍适合于复杂数据建模的图形工具----实体-关系图。三、实体-关系图----DD(DataDictionary)项目六物联网应用软件设计6.1软件测试

(1)数据对象、属性与关系数据(data)---是信息的载体,它能够被计算机识别、存储和加工处理。它是计算机程序加工的“原料”对象(Object)---是一个包含数据以及这些数据有关的操作的集合属性(Property)---是用于描述数据对象特征的标识码型号制造商车体类型颜色买主关于汽车属性描述表项目六物联网应用软件设计6.1软件测试

(2)实体-关系图0:11:10:多1:多-----实体-关系图中数量对应关系的表示符号制造商制造车-----一个简单的实体-关系图和数据对象项目六物联网应用软件设计6.1软件测试

谢谢观看!

文档评论(0)

1亿VIP精品文档

相关文档